Cheeseburger Salad

A classic burger, in salad form! Cheeseburger salad has all the flavors of a burger, without the bun. Easy to make and super tasty.

Ingredients

Servings

For the beef

  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 teaspoon seasoned salt
  • ½ teaspoon pepper
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der

For the salad

  • Lettuce or salad greens
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es
  • ½ cup Pickles
  • ½ cup cheddar cheese
  • ½ cup red onion

For the dressing (aka burger sauce)

  • ½ cup mayonnaise
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¼ te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 tablespoons ketchup
  • 1 tablespoon ma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on dill relish
  • 1 tablespoon yellow mustard
  • 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Instructions

Cook the ground beef

  1. In a large skillet, brown the ground beef and drain off any excess grease. Add the seasonings and continue to cook until done. Set aside to cool.

Make the sauce

  1. Combine all sauce ingredients in a bowl. Set aside.

Prep the salad

  1. Cut the lettuce into bite sized pieces, halve the tomatoes, chop the pickles, shred the cheese and slice the onions.

Assemble

  1. Add the lettuce to a large bowl, then add the salad ingredients in separate piles
  2. Add the cooled ground beef, and drizzle the sauce over the top, or serve with bowls of sauce to be added before eating.

Notes

  • What to do with leftovers
  • Store leftover components separ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ator. The ground beef should be used within 3-4 days, and the vegetables and cheese within a week. Assemble the salad just before serving to keep it fresh.
  • Substitutions/Additions
  • If you're really missing the bun, you could use croutons, or a garnish with sesame seeds.
  • You can make a cheeseburger salad with ground beef or ground turkey (or any ground meat). If you opt for chicken or turkey, bump up the seasoning so you have good flavor in your ground meat.
